Now, it’s been two whole years. On Thursday, Caitlin shared a sweet anniversary post that had fans swooning. “Another year with my favorite person 🙂 I’m so thankful for you 🖤🖤,” she wrote. The Indiana Fever star dropped two black-and-white pics of her and McCaffery—who’s now coaching at Butler—to mark the occasion.

The couple started dating back in April 2023, when both were still in college.  While Clark went on to break records and shake the world as a Hawkeye, McCaffery was also doing his thing. After graduating in 2023, he got a gig with the Indiana Pacers but later took up a coaching spot with Butler’s men’s basketball team. And through all of it, their relationship grew stronger. 

On their first anniversary, it was McCaffery who posted with sweet words. “One year w the best… doing life w u has been easy… can’t wait to watch u live out ur dreams in person. love you,” he wrote.
